Subtract 30/36 from 48/42
1st number: 1 6/42, 2nd number: 30/36
48/42 - 30/36 is 13/42.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 42 and 36 is 252
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 252 - For the 1st fraction, since 42 × 6 = 252,
48/42 = 48 × 6/42 × 6 = 288/252 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 36 × 7 = 252,
30/36 = 30 × 7/36 × 7 = 210/252 - Subtract the two like fractions:
288/252 - 210/252 = 288 - 210/252 = 78/252 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 13/42
